New FTIR in the CCMR Bard Materials Facility

The CCMR Bard Materials Facility is continuing to support the Bruker Vertex V80V vacuum FTIR system, previously in the NBTC. The system has a spectral range of 500 to 6000 cm-1 and the evacuated optical bench significantly reduces atmospheric noise and provides a very stable measurement environment. The vacuum environment, combined with a low temperature MCT detector proves to be a very effective combination for measuring samples with low signal and samples with peaks lying in the water vapor regions. Additional accessories include: ATR, variable angle specular reflectance and heated flow cells. Please see the instrument page and contact Philip Carubia for further information.
